    How is Ahmad Hardy Doing Now? Missouri RB Status Revealed After Mississippi Concert Shooting

    Ahmad Hardy exploded in both the 2024 and 2025 campaigns, but the elite running back suffered an offseason setback after a shooting. Hardy was shot at a concert on early Sunday morning.

    According to a statement from Missouri posted on Monday on X, Hardy underwent surgery and is now in stable condition. No additional information was provided, and his return timeline was not announced. The situation appears to remain somewhat fluid.

    “Ahmad underwent surgery Sunday in Mississippi and is in stable condition. Ahmad is deeply loved by his teammates, coaches, friends, family and fans. We will continue to stand beside him and his family through this difficult time, offering our love, prayers, strength and support.”

    Hardy’s injury came in the wake of his first season with the Missouri Tigers, his first with the team since transferring from the Louisiana-Monroe Warhawks after the 2024 season. Hardy led the Sun Belt in rushing yards and rushing touchdowns in 2024 and led the SEC in rushing yards and yards per carry in 2025.

    Ahmad Hardy Enters Potential Race Against Time

    With Ahmad Hardy now seemingly through the worst but out of action for the foreseeable future, a range of outcomes is possible. On one hand, a quick recovery could get the running back on the gridiron in time for the buildup to the regular season. However, depending on the nature of the wound, it could take him into the regular season to recover.

    If it is the former situation, the back should have little to worry about. However, if the wound comes with an extended recovery, Hardy could miss some or all of the season. Even a delay that extends into training camp could force Missouri to fill in the gap with another back.

    Once that back gets into games, his production could put Hardy on the back burner. As such, the pressure could be on Hardy to do whatever he can to make sure his recovery goes off without a hitch.

    According to Missouri, the team has seven running backs on the roster, including Hardy.
